xHVS-3000 SELECTED FEATURES

  • Immobilizer Test: Ensure the vehicle is unable to move unexpectedly.
  • Insulation Resistance Test: Ensuring there is no breakdown in the insulation of the charge circuit of the vehicle, which could result in high-voltage shock.  
  • Equipotential Ground Bonding Test: Inadequate grounding can lead to erratic system behavior, increased shock risk, or improper functioning of safety mechanisms.
  • AC Touch Current Test: Verify that vehicle protections prevent AC leakage current from faulty EVSE, reducing the risk of electric shock.

xHVS USE CASES

Dealer Service Advisor – Quick inspection during vehicle write-up

Dealer Service Technician – Thorough safety inspection pre/post service

Dealer Used Car Technician – Thorough safety inspection for trade-in appraisal

First Responders – Quick “on scene” risk assessment

Collision Repair Technician – Collision repair verification; safety inspection pre/post repair

Tow Truck Driver – Safety check prior to tow

Insurance Adjuster – Thorough safety inspection supporting estimation of total repair cost

Regulated Safety Inspection (PTI) – Required safety inspection for vehicle registration
